Winning Best Retail Catering – Gold was a fantastic moment for us. This is the second time in three years that Hull City have received this award and it means a great deal to the entire team. We were up against strong competition from across the Premier League and EFL, including Brentford and Spurs, but our commitment to quality, innovation and fan experience stood out.
Retail catering at Hull City has been transformed over recent seasons. We have grown the spend per head to £5.50, after breaking the SPH record seven times already this season. This is the result of investment in street food concepts, dynamic menus and smart use of fan engagement.
Supporters now have the chance to vote each month for new dishes such as Toad in the Hole, Texas Brisket Burnt Ends and Sweet and Sour Chicken. It is a simple but powerful way to involve fans in shaping their matchday experience. We are also proud of the local provenance of our ingredients, with pork sourced within nine miles and beef always from Yorkshire.

We were also delighted to receive Silver in Best Non-Matchday Sales Team, marking the second year running Hull City has been recognised in this category.
This award is based on a mystery shop of the sales experience for conference and event enquiries. It covers everything from how well we understand the brief to how professionally and politely we respond. Coming second only to Manchester City is no small achievement.
This success is down to the dedication of Katie West, Kathryn Drury, Joe Brewer and Sarah Shepherdson, who have worked consistently to grow the business through strong relationships, local insight and a deep connection to the Hull community. Despite increased competition from the Bonus Arena and the new DoubleTree by Hilton, the team has retained the majority of its business, with many clients returning after trying alternatives. The reason is simple. They get better food and better service.
We have also brought our street food concepts into the conference and events side, including the Christmas offer. We have moved away from tradition for its own sake and created an eclectic mix of menus designed to appeal to all tastes. This approach helps us keep our DDR rates competitive while delivering real value.
